5-Ingredient Black Bean Pasta (Chili Mac and Cheese)

A black bean pasta recipe (also known as chili mac and cheese) made with only 5 ingredients in up to 15 minutes. You can cook on the stovetop, slow cooker, or pressure cooker. It is comforting,  mildly spicy, cheesy, and so delicious!

5-Ingredient Black Bean Pasta (Chili Mac and Cheese)
Prep time
5 min
Cook time
10 min
Yield
6 servings
Difficulty
MEDIUM

Ingredients

Quantities are shown as originally provided.

  • 1 lb ground beef (80% lean meat and 20% fat (at room temperature))
  • 1 2.5 oz chili seasoning mix
  • 4 cups water
  • 1 16 oz elbow pasta (FOR A GF MEAL, USE A GLUTEN-FREE PASTA)
  • 1 16 oz can black beans (drained)
  • 2 cups shredded cheddar cheese (mild)

Instructions

  1. 1

    STOVETOPBrown the beef: In a large nonstick saucepan, brown the ground beef over medium-high, stirring every now and then, for about 5-6 minutes or until no longer pink. Stir in the chili seasoning mix and let cook for about 1 minute. Cook the pasta: Stir in water, pasta, drained black beans, and salt (if desired).  Bring to a boil, reduce heat to medium-low, cover, and allow pasta to cook for 8-10 minutes or just until al dente. If you’d like to, stir in diced tomatoes. Stir in cheese and then sprinkle the herbs on top. Serve while hot.

  2. 2

    SLOW COOKERCook the beef and stir in chili seasoning mix as stated in the stovetop directions above. Then combine the water, pasta, tomatoes (optional), drained black beans, and salt (optional) in the slow cooker and cook on high for about 2 hours, or until pasta is al dente. If needed, cook longer or until pasta is al dente, checking every 20 minutes after those 2 hours. When pasta has finished cooking, stir in the cheese until melted. Garnish with herbs and serve hot.

  3. 3

    PRESSURE COOKERTurn on the sauté function and let heat enough to brown the beef (about 5-6 minutes) or until no longer pink. Stir in the chili seasoning and let cook for about 1 minute. Then stir in water, pasta, tomatoes (optional), and drained black beans. Turn off the sauté function, lock the lid and turn the valve, and set to cook at high pressure on pasta mode or manual mode for 3 minutes. The pasta will be al dente! Do a quick release and remove the lid. Taste and adjust the salt if needed, stir in the cheese until melted, garnish with herbs, and serve hot!
